    Embiid doesn't have the footwork or the quickness that Hakeem had. Many people forget that Hakeem could move almost like a guard could, he had a very quick first step and an arsenal of moves that demanded a double team. Hakeem also had a much higher defensive IQ, knew how to guard his opponents and was rarely caught sleeping or giving up backdoor points or easy shots.

    If I were to compare Embiid to a past player I would probably compare him to David Robinson or maybe Rick Schmits simply based on the way he can face up and shoot the basketball. But, he doesn't have the array of moves or the agility that Dream had, nor does he posses the same passing skills or defensive awareness despite being a good shot blocker.
